General Laws of Massachusetts - Chapter 231 Pleading and Practice - Section 85F Imputation of negligence of operator of motor vehicle to passenger-owner

Section 85F. In an action to recover damages for death or for injuries or property damage arising out of an accident or collision in which a motor vehicle was involved while the owner thereof was a passenger therein, the negligence of the operator of such motor vehicle shall not be imputed to the owner for the sole reason that he was a passenger.
